
The Keys to the Temple by Penny Billington
Dion Fortune was one of the most significant occultists of the twentieth century and is still considered to be a major influence on the current Western Mystery Tradition. Fortune wrote one of the first modern accounts of the Tree of Life and the system of the Qabalah that makes ancient mythology and the mysteries behind them come to life here and now. She also wrote a series of novels that on one level can be read as slightly unusual romance novels but on a deeper level contain key images and patterns from those mysteries which speak to our subconscious and, if consciously related to, bring us into a deeper experience of our life and being. The Keys to the Temple is a guide to working with Fortune's writing for your own spiritual transformation. With hands-on exercises and supportive instructions, this book will enable you to directly discover and apply the keys of the temple to your life.
Penny Billington (Somerset, UK) is an active member in the Order of Bards, Ovates and Druids and has edited its magazine, Touchstone, for more than a decade. She regularly runs workshops, organizes rituals, and gives lectures. Ian Rees (Glastonbury, Somerset, UK) is a psycho-spiritual psychotherapist. He designed MA programs and taught at the Karuna Institute in Devon from 1999 to 2009. Since 2009 he has concentrated on developing and presenting workshops for the Annwn Foundation.
